Available:Product Details:
  • Focused on fun and featuring our Mixed-Wheel Trail Geometry, the Status frameset is a fewer frills, all thrills FSR delivery system crafted from our hard-charging—and hard-wearing—M5 alloy and is designed not only to take a hit, but keep asking for more.
  • Fox's FLOAT 36 Rhythm calls their venerable Grip damper into service in the name of adventurous riders everywhere, offering impressively controlled travel with plenty of trail-feel that puts confidence on speed dial. The two-position Sweep adjustment ensures the FLOAT 36 Rhythm is right at home dealing out its 140-millimeters (Status 140) or 160-millimeters (Status 160) of travel in just about any environment while 36-millimeter stanchions promise plenty of stiffness for precise handling at the limit.
  • Quality suspension unlocks some serious free speed, so to slow it all down, we tasked SRAM's proven Code R brakes with stopping duties. Forged four-piston calipers offer serious stopping power, while 200-millimeter rotors on both ends of the bike promise plenty of fade-free bite when it matters.

I purchased a 140 online and called a store to reserve a 160 that they will let me try when they get it, I will probably compare both when they get here and keep one. I was worried about some comments on these not being good for climbing when I reserved the 160 and that's why I decided to order a 140 for hybrid trails.

The value on these is undeniable, good frame with great components. Components wise this beats the StumpJumper by a long shot for a similar price. I was looking at the Stumpjumper alloy as well but the parts on that are very entry-level and I believe too cheap for a $3000 bike. This one instead has better brakes, much better suspension, drivetrain, etc., the frame geometry on the SJ wins from what I've read though.

Anyways, I think this is a good deal for a the brand and components.
